Xylazine is actually a medicine provided to animals to sedate them for surgical treatment or decrease discomfort. Xylazine, from time to time known as tranq, is not really accredited for human use. Nevertheless, xylazine is now getting used as being a leisure drug.

Investigate has demonstrated xylazine is often added to illicit opioids, together with fentanyl,3 and people report applying xylazine-made up of fentanyl to lengthen its euphoric effects.

Fentanyl and xylazine have an additive impact on the CNS and respiratory depression that can lead to arrest and Demise. Individuals exhibiting indications of a fentanyl overdose who definitely have shown minor to no advancement with the administration of naloxone ought to be suspected of the xylazine overdose or another etiology of their affliction.

The first step in administration could well be to simply call a poison Regulate Heart; a toxicology expert can recommend the best procedure method. If the individual is hemodynamically unstable, has serious respiratory depression with impending respiratory failure, or involves closer monitoring and considerable nursing care determined by real-time medical judgment, the crucial care group or intensivist ought to be consulted.

Nevertheless, some individuals may perhaps knowingly abuse xylazine to aid lengthen the euphoric influence (“superior”) from fentanyl injections. Those who inject drugs are at a superior risk for publicity to xylazine because of its escalating prevalence about the streets.

Xylazine may be smoked, snorted, swallowed or injected. Usually, people today are not aware of its existence in other drugs. Xylazine exam strips may perhaps detect xylazine in liquid or powder form. On the other hand, these examination strips tend to be only accessible to professional medical gurus.

However, in animal models, higher doses of xylazine bring about extreme alpha-one and alpha-2b receptor activation, which may lead to adverse sympathomimetic effects like hypertensive emergencies, cerebrovascular incidents, and myocardial infarctions. The immediate vasoconstrictive impact of xylazine activating peripheral alpha-2b receptors within the vascular smooth muscles, resulting in decreased skin perfusion, is regarded as the pathophysiology of skin ulcers that produce as a consequence of Continual use.
